TURNER v. WEEKS

No. 79-1422.

384 So.2d 193 (1980)

Julie Catherine TURNER and James Michael Turner, Appellants, v. Martha Lou Fletcher WEEKS and Montine S. McDonald, As Personal Representative of the Estate of Emma Hicks, Deceased, Appellees.

District Court of Appeal of Florida, Second District.

Rehearing Denied June 11, 1980.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Paul S. Buchman and J. Miles Buchman of Buchman & Buchman, Plant City, for appellants.

Leroy H. Merkle, Jr., Tampa, for appellee Martha Lou Fletcher Weeks.


GRIMES, Chief Judge.

This appeal involves an examination of the interplay between the antilapse statute and the laws of adoption.

Emma Hicks, who died on February 18, 1979, executed a will in 1966 which read in part:
